Pretrial
Services
The Pretrial
Services Unit of the Criminal Law Division is located on the first
floor. The main responsibility of Pretrial Services is to
interview defendants arrested on felony charges. Interviews
are scored based on residency, length of time in the greater
Sacramento area, employment and criminal history. This
information is provided to the magistrate (judge on call) for
determination as to whether the defendant should be released on
his or her own recognizance. This unit operates seven days a
week, twenty-four hours a day.
